Trump threatens Slotkin, other members of Congress with jail time over video to military
Responding to a video posted on social media by members of Congress, including U.S. Senator Elissa Slotkin of Michigan, President Donald Trump labeled the recording “SEDITIOUS BEHAVIOR" that's “punishable by DEATH!"

NTSB releases first report into UPS plane crash in Kentucky that killed 14
The NTSB's preliminary report showed one of the engines broke off from the wing as the plane took off and burst into flames. The plane never made it more than 30 feet above ground level.
